Punjabi idioms ( Muhavare ) and proverbs ( Akhaan ) are the heartbeat of the Punjabi language, distilling centuries of cultural wisdom and humor into short, punchy phrases. While they are often grouped together, are complete sentences expressing a universal truth, whereas Muhavare are metaphorical phrases that need to be integrated into a sentence to make sense.

: These are phrases that have a figurative meaning, which is usually different from the literal meaning of the individual words. For example, saying "Kalejey te patthar rakh ke" (Having a heart of stone) doesn't mean someone has a rock inside their chest; it figuratively means the person is being heartless and cruel. Muhavare are fixed phrases that add color and intensity to the language.

Punjabi: ਨੀਮ ਹਕੀਮ ਖਤਰਨਾਕ। Transliteration: Nīm hakīm khatarnāk. Literal: A half-doctor is dangerous. Meaning: Half-knowledge is risky. Example (Punjabi): ਨੀਮ ਹਕੀਮ ਖਤਰਨਾਕ — ਪਹਿਲਾਂ ਪੂਰੀ ਜਾਣਕਾਰੀ ਲੈ ਲੋ। Example (English): Half-knowledge is dangerous — get full information first.
